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Installation and wiring: Decide between plug-in or hardwired installations. Ensure your bathroom’s electrical setup and wall space can accommodate the unit’s dimensions and mounting method.
- Heating performance: Look for a model with adjustable temperature settings and a fast heat-up time. Consider whether you want a wide range (115°F–155°F) or a narrower, pre-set range for convenience.
- Safety features: Prioritize IPX4 or higher waterproof ratings, overheat protection, and automatic shut-off timers to prevent energy waste and accidents.
- Size and capacity: For households with multiple towels or robes, a larger bar count (6–10 bars) provides more drying space. Smaller units work well in compact bathrooms or powder rooms.
- Finish and style: Choose finishes (stainless steel brushed nickel, matte black, brushed nickel) that complement existing fixtures and décor to maintain a cohesive look.
- Durability and materials: Stainless steel bodies tend to resist rust in humid environments. Verify that the core heating elements are rated for continuous operation.
- Energy efficiency: Timers and auto shut-off features reduce energy use. Look for models with memory or programmable schedules to tailor usage to daily routines.
- Maintenance and cleaning: Smooth surfaces and accessible design simplify cleaning and towel drying. Consider models with rounded bars to minimize snagging and ease of towel placement.
